@RustyFrench12344 жыл бұрын
When you cut up your plastic bag to use, avoid the printed part or it may transfer onto your rice paper!

You had mentioned in another comment below you would do a demo on how you did your cake for this jellyfish tutorial. Have you done this anywhere? If not, was it accommplished through wafter paper on it (similar to how you did your other tutorial with a cake that had wafer paper)? Beautiful!
@RustyFrench12344 жыл бұрын
SweetWorks of Art Hi, thank you. No, I haven’t done that style again yet, sorry. It is textured and torn fondant with the only wafer paper being the white ‘foam’ that runs down the left side of the cake. To get texture on the fondant you torch the surface and then roll over it to crackle. I also rolled large sugar crystals into some areas. Apply strips of the torn-edge fondant diagonally down the cake, overlapping pieces and curling back the edges. I hope this helps a little. I’ll try to make this my next tutorial.
